2-es
verb suffixDefinition of -ES
—used to form the third person singular present of most verbs that end in s <blesses>, z <fizzes>, sh <hushes>, ch <catches>, or a final y that changes to i <defies> — compare 3-s
Origin of -ES
Middle English — more at 3-s
